Read the sentence.

Andrea's opponent was honest and straightforward, but Andrea used her guile to win the contest.

What type of context clue in the sentence can be used to determine the meaning of guile?

a definition
a synonym
an antonym
an inference

Answer:

An antonym

Step-by-step explanation:

In the given sentence, the context clue that would assist the readers in finding the meaning of the word 'guile' would be 'the antonym of the word.'

The first part of the sentence talks about the characteristics of Andrea's opponent and the use of 'but' symbolizes the contrasting character traits.

This will help the readers get the opposite meaning of the word 'guile' and hence, they can infer that 'guile' means the opposite of 'honest and straightforward' i.e. 'deceptive and cunning.'
